Hydro Encryption component

A cipher suite to enable encryption and decryption of data messages, based on libhydrogen.

Macro reference

hash_keygen

hash_keygen
Creates a secret key suitable for use with the hash_hash function. You must provide a 32 byte array for the key. 
- BYTE key
 
- VOID Return


hash_with_key

hash_with_key
Creates a hash fingerprint of the data, using the given key. Returns 0 if successful. 
- BYTE hash
Buffer for the hash. Size >=32 makes it practically impossible for two messages to produce the same fingerprint. 
- BYTE data
The data buffer to be processed 
- UINT size
Byte count of the data to be processed 
- BYTE key
Key to be used 
- INT Return


hash_without_key

hash_without_key
Creates a hash fingerprint of the data, which will always have the same fingerprint, similar to the MD5 or SHA-1 Returns 0 if successful. 
- BYTE hash
Buffer for the hash. Size >=32 makes it practically impossible for two messages to produce the same fingerprint. 
- BYTE data
Data buffer to be processed 
- UINT size
Byte count of data to be processed 
- INT Return


init

init
Initialisation function. To be called at the very start of your program. 
- INT Return


secretbox_decrypt

secretbox_decrypt
Decrypts a message with a secret key. A single key is used both to encrypt/sign and verify/decrypt messages. For this reason, it is critical to keep the key confidential. Returns 0 on success. 
- BYTE message
Buffer for the decrypted message. Size must be at least length - 36 
- UINT length
The length (byte count) of the ciphertext 
- UINT ID
Message ID. Must match with the original message ID. Can be 0 
- BYTE key
The secret key 
- BYTE ciphertext
Buffer containing the ciphertext to be decrypted. 
- INT Return


secretbox_encrypt

secretbox_encrypt
Encrypts a message with a secret key. A single key is used both to encrypt/sign and verify/decrypt messages. For this reason, it is critical to keep the key confidential. Returns 0 on success. 
- BYTE message
Buffer containing the message to be encrypted. 
- UINT length
The length (byte count) of the message 
- UINT ID
Message ID. Can be 0 
- BYTE key
The secret key 
- BYTE ciphertext
Buffer for ciphertext output. Buffer size must be at least length + 36 
- INT Return


secretbox_keygen

secretbox_keygen
Creates a secret key suitable for use with the secretbox functions. You must provide a 32 byte array for the key. 
- BYTE key
 
- VOID Return


sign_create

sign_create
Computes a signature for a message using the secret key. Returns 0 if successful. 
- BYTE signature
Buffer to receive the signature. Must be 64 bytes. 
- BYTE message
Buffer containing the data to sign 
- UINT message_size
Byte count of the message 
- BYTE secret_key
Secret/Private key to be used.Size is 64 bytes. 
- INT Return


sign_keygen

sign_keygen
Creates Private and Public key pair to sign and verify messages. Returns 0 if successful. 
- BYTE Secret
Buffer to receive the Private/Secret Key. Buffer size must be 64 bytes 
- BYTE Public
Buffer to receive the Public key. Buffer size must be 32 bytes 
- INT Return


sign_verify

sign_verify
Verify the signature of a mesasge using the public key. Returns 0 if successful. 
- BYTE signature
Buffer to receive the signature. Must be 64 bytes. 
- BYTE message
Buffer containing the data to sign 
- UINT message_size
Byte count of the message 
- BYTE public_key
Public key to be used.Size is 32 bytes. 
- INT Return
